People living with disabilities often face unique challenges in their daily lives. Simple tasks that others may take for granted, such as using the restroom, can become difficult or even dangerous for those with mobility issues. To address this issue, many businesses and public facilities have installed disabled toilet alarms to ensure the safety and well-being of their disabled patrons. In recent years, a new advancement in this technology has emerged: the wireless disabled toilet alarm.
A wireless disabled toilet alarm operates in much the same way as a traditional alarm system, but without the need for wires or a complex installation process. One of the main advantages of a wireless disabled toilet alarm is its ease of installation. Traditional wired alarm systems can be costly and time-consuming to install, requiring extensive wiring and construction work. In contrast, a wireless system can be set up in a matter of hours, with minimal disruption to the existing infrastructure. This not only saves businesses money on installation costs, but also allows them to quickly implement a safety measure that can benefit their disabled customers.
Another key advantage of a wireless disabled toilet alarm is its flexibility. Because it does not rely on physical wiring, a wireless system can be easily relocated or expanded as needed. This is particularly useful for businesses that may need to reconfigure their facilities or add new toilet alarm systems in the future. With a wireless system, businesses can adapt to changing needs without the added expense and hassle of rewiring.
In addition to these practical benefits, a wireless disabled toilet alarm also offers increased reliability and security. Traditional wired systems can be vulnerable to power outages or tampering, which can compromise the safety of disabled individuals in an emergency. By using wireless technology, businesses can ensure that their toilet alarms remain operational even in the event of a power failure. Furthermore, wireless systems are often equipped with advanced security features, such as encrypted signals and tamper-resistant devices, to prevent unauthorized access or interference.
One of the most significant advantages of a wireless disabled toilet alarm is its accessibility. For individuals with disabilities, navigating a public restroom can be a daunting task. A wireless alarm system provides an added layer of security and peace of mind, allowing disabled individuals to call for help quickly and easily in the event of an emergency. With a simple push of a button, users can alert staff or emergency services to their location, ensuring a swift response in the event of a fall or other medical emergency.
